comparemela.com

Top Locations Tagged with Stems Inc

Stems Inc in United States - 99503/Florist near anchorage/Florist near Anchorage Municipality

1). Stems Inc, Artesian Village, AK

Stems Inc in United States - 12571/Florist near Dutchess

2). Stems Inc

Stems Inc in Canada - /Florist near st -john's/Florist near St Johns

3). Sweet Stems Inc St John Newfoundland And Labrador Nl Canada

Stems Inc in United States - 11003/Florist near Nassau

4). Stems Inc, Linden Blvd

vimarsana © 2020. All Rights Reserved.